00001 <?php 00002 /* $Id: 0albums.php,v 1.1 2003/09/25 18:59:22 mikko Exp $ */ 00003 /* 00004 * ImaComm - a web based photo album software 00005 * Copyright (C) 2003, Mikko Kokkonen 00006 * 00007 * This program is free software; you can redistribute it and/or modify 00008 * it under the terms of the GNU General Public License as published by 00009 * the Free Software Foundation; either version 2 of the License, or (at 00010 * your option) any later version. 00011 * 00012 * This program is distributed in the hope that it will be useful, but 00013 * WITHOUT ANY WARRANTY; without even the implied warranty of 00014 *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U 00015 * General Public License for more details. 00016 * 00017 * You should have received a copy of the GNU General Public License 00018 * along with this program; if not, write to the Free Software 00019 *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307, USA. 00020 */ 00021 if (function_exists("posix_getpwuid") && function_exists("posix_getuid")) 00022 { 00023 $__info = posix_getpwuid(posix_getuid()); 00024 $__grpinf = posix_getgrgid($__info['uid']); 00025 $__info = "(Username: ".$__info['name'].", group: ".$__grpinf['name'].")"; 00026 } 00027 00028 // Generate default album path (ImaComm installion folder -> up one step -> albums) 00029 $path = dirname($_SERVER['PHP_SELF']); 00030 $path = explode("/", $path); 00031 array_pop($path); array_pop($path); array_push($path, "albums"); 00032 $path = implode("/", $path); 00033 $module = array( 00034 "name" => "Albums path", 00035 "var" => "albums", 00036 "type" => "webpath", 00037 "serious" => true, 00038 "description" => "Please give path to the directory where ImaComm can save albums. This directory must be PHP writable $__info", 00039 "default" => $path); 00040 ?>
1.3